GloLEE·Dumbbell Lateral Raise·2024-08-27

If you turn to the side like in the video, your shoulder will get caught. It's better to lift it slightly forward.

Instead of keeping your body completely parallel, adjust the direction of your arms so that the angle between them is about 120-150 degrees when viewed from above. This will allow you to perform the movement without shoulder tension.
